  • Monterey: Nestled along the stunning California coastline, Monterey is a vibrant city known for its rich maritime history and breathtaking scenery. As the home of Old Monterey, this area offers a unique blend of outdoor activities, from beach strolls to scenic hikes. Visitors can explore the famous Cannery Row, enjoy the local aquarium, and indulge in shopping at charming boutiques. The iconic Monterey Bay provides a picturesque backdrop for relaxation, while the nearby boardwalk and amusement park add to the fun. With its mild climate, the city's allure remains strong year-round, particularly peaking in the summer months.
  • Pacific Grove: Just 3.2km from Old Monterey, Pacific Grove is a quaint coastal town that captivates visitors with its beautiful scenery and outdoor recreational opportunities. Renowned for its stunning beaches and the nearby Point Pinos Lighthouse, this city is perfect for leisurely strolls and picnics. Pacific Grove is also home to charming shops and delightful cafes, making it an ideal spot to unwind. The town's proximity to the scenic national state park offers hiking trails and breathtaking views of the Pacific Ocean, making it a must-visit for nature lovers. The arrival of spring brings the famous Monarch butterfly migration, adding to its unique charm.
  • Seaside: Located 4.8km from Old Monterey, Seaside is a lively city that offers a mix of outdoor adventures and cultural experiences. Known for its beautiful beaches and vibrant boardwalk, it's a great place to enjoy various activities, including motor racing and shopping. The city's fairground hosts numerous events throughout the year, attracting locals and tourists alike. Seaside also boasts stunning views of the bay, making it a fantastic spot for sunset watching. Its welcoming atmosphere ensures that visitors will find plenty to explore and enjoy, regardless of the season.

Find the best attractions near Old Monterey

Old Monterey is perfect for outdoor and beach vacations, featuring attractions like the beach, jetty, and nature preserves. Visitors can enjoy a blend of culture and family-friendly activities, with highlights including the Center of Monterey and the Monterey Museum. This charming area offers a scenic escape for travelers looking to explore local points of interest.

  • Cannery Row: A historic waterfront street, Cannery Row is known for its vibrant atmosphere filled with shops, restaurants, and art galleries. Originally a sardine canning district, it now offers a unique blend of culture and entertainment, making it a must-visit for tourists.
  • Fisherman's Wharf: This charming jetty is perfect for a leisurely stroll, offering stunning views of the bay. Explore seafood markets, dine at waterfront eateries, and catch sight of sea lions basking in the sun. It's an ideal spot for enjoying local cuisine and fresh catches.
  • Carmel Beach: Renowned for its picturesque scenery, Carmel Beach features soft white sands and stunning ocean views. Perfect for relaxation, beach walks, and stunning sunsets, it’s a tranquil escape from the bustle of city life.

Best time to go to Old Monterey

The best time to visit Old Monterey is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. September is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ny with no rain. December is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January52.3°F (11.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
February52.0°F (11.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
March52.9°F (11.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
April54.5°F (12.5°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
May56.7°F (13.7°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
June60.4°F (15.8°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ighAverage
July63.0°F (17.2°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ighSlightly High
August63.9°F (17.7°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ighSlightly High
September64.0°F (17.8°C)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
October61.3°F (16.3°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
November55.9°F (13.3°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
December51.8°F (11.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Old Monterey

Traveling to Old Monterey is convenient with several nearby airports. Norman Y. Mineta San Jose International Airport (SJC) is located 85.3km away, with hotels like the 5-star Shashi Hotel Mountain View Palo Alto and the 4.5-star Santa Clara Marriott within proximity. Monterey Peninsula Airport (MRY) is just 3.2km from Old Monterey, offering nearby accommodations such as the luxurious Hyatt Regency Monterey Hotel & Spa. Additionally, Salinas Municipal Airport (SNS) is 25.7km away, with options including the Residence Inn by Marriott Salinas Monterey. Each airport provides accessible transportation options to their respective hotels, ensuring a smooth arrival for your vacation.
